#209446 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#209446 is composed of 12.5% red, 58%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 139.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 35.3%. #209446 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ff8c with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#209446 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#209446 has RGB values of R:32, G:148,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2135110.

Shades and Tints of #209446
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#209446
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575d59 is the less saturated color, while #04b03c is the most saturated one.
